Let me share with you how to use the bending brake to create a border.
Parts list
Bending brake
Four clamps
Sheet metal
Hammer

Here is my bending brake clamped down to my workbench. I like it clamped down instead of bolted because when I'm done, I just store it away in a cupboard.

First, mark the metal where you want it bent. Then align perfectly along the edge where the brake will be lifted. 

Then place the metal bar on top of your piece and clamp it down tightly. 

Now lift! Duh, I realized I should have placed the clamps closer to the piece for a better lift. I also realized having the piece closer to an edge helps too. 

Also, be sure to anneal your piece first, to get a nice crisp line.

Now, lay your piece perpendicular to a solid surface (I used the bending brake) and lightly hammer down the border. You can use the channel to place something into it and then hammer down. Fabric? An etched piece? Lot's of design possibilities here.

Then, place on a metal surface and hammer the border down. Looking at this picture I realize my steel block is quite pathetic. Maybe I should have purchased a bigger one instead of a bending brake!

After hammering, you can then add a unique texture to your border.

Here is how I did it and what I used. This is in no way a tutorial because I am still learning myself, but I wanted to share my results and a few things I learned along the way.

My supplies. 
The Ingot mold and Crucible I purchased at PMC Supplies on Ebay. I like the reversible one because you can make nice thick ring shanks. If you want to melt copper too, make sure you get the right ingot mold and crucible. 

Ohhh pretty flame. It's Photoshopped, I couldn't help myself! You get the idea though, you'll need a nice big beautiful flame!

The torch I use is a Smith Air/Acetylene torch, and for this project I used the #3 tip. 

First, I heated up the crucible and ingot mold. 
I then filled my crucible with a few pieces of silver and Borax. I guess Borax acts like a flux to help melt the metal quicker. After it started to melt, I added more pieces of silver.

Here we go!

When it started to get molten, I turned the crucible more to the side to get ready to pour. Anyone else see the creepy skeleton face?!?!!! WTH! Seriously. freaky.

And..pour quickly!

Ummm. yeah..epic fail. I poured too slowly and it created this interesting looking blob. Gotta pour fast!

I just reheated and poured again and got this. Much better. Although, I should have taken advantage of making the ingot shape smaller and it would have been a better shape. Oh well, next time!


So yeah..I made a boot. Hahahaha! That's okay, it's 20 gauge thick and will work well for backplates etc. Any suggestions on how to prevent cracking when rolling would be greatly appreciated. I did anneal it about 5 times. Maybe more annealing?

"Marriage of Metals" technique & tutorial

Carol Dekle-Foss
I learned this cool technique a couple months ago in my intermediate metalsmith class. I just LOVE it! I have always been attracted to geometric patterns and also mixing different metals. This technique was perfect for me to explore in my jewelry designs. These earrings are my latest creation, and for my first Boot Camp post, I'm going to show the readers of LMAJ how I made them. Tools & Materials on the bottom of the page.

Step one
Create the shapes you want on a computer software program such as Photoshop and print on regular paper.

Step two
Select your sheet metals, making sure they are all the same gauge. For the earrings I used sterling silver, copper and brass.

Step three
With a triangle, sharpie and a ruler, mark your shapes on the metal using the printout as a guide. Make sure your lines are a bit larger due to loss when cutting out and sanding. You will only need the basic geometric shapes for now.

Step four

 Cut out the sheet metal. I prefer a metal shear for the most accurate cuts. Here is my throatless shear from harbor freight. It's great for cutting accurate lines, and saves me tons of time in the studio.
Step five
Place sandpaper on a flat surface and run metal edges over it lightly to remove burs and even out the metals edges. 
Step six

Place metal pieces on flat surface and line up making sure every piece touches with no gaps for best results. Also for earrings, position pieces to form a mirror image.

Next, flux and then with the flux brush pick up solder pieces and place where joins meet. In the pic below you can see the solder pieces positioned. I cut them in thin rectangle shapes to try and prevent solder from flowing all over the metal, and hopefully to only go in the cracks of the joins. Keep in mind, solder flows wherever the heck it wants too anyway.

Step seven
Solder the pieces with a fairly large flame. Copper and brass have a higher melting temperature so you want to focus your flame on those pieces and avoid the sterling silver so you don't melt it. I use the Smith torch purchased from Cyberweld. This is where my teacher referred me to purchase mine in case you are in the market for one. NOTE: Soldering is a technique you have to practice to master. It takes time and patience, so don't be too hard on yourself if you are having difficulty. I know I struggled for a long time. If you want to learn I recommend taking a metalsmith class, or find a mentor to teach you the basics. If you have specific questions feel free to contact me and I will try to help! Also if you haven't discovered Nancy Hamilton you are in for a treat! She is so much fun to learn from. Here is a youtube video from her on soldering basics.

Here is the front of the pieces after pickling. You can see the solder flowed through in some areas. The back is a hot mess, as you can see in the below pics.
Step eight
Place paper shape onto metal and mark with sharpie. Then cut out with jewelers saw.

Step nine
 Sand edges with a belt sander or a bastard file.
Here is my sander from Harbor Freight. Again, a major time saver, and you can't beat the price. I hate filing and will avoid it at all costs.

Next, place the piece on top of the other and line up. Mark with sharpie and then saw out with jewelers saw.
